GNU bug report logs - #18327
24.4.50; [PATCH] vector QPattern for pcase

Previous Next

Package: emacs;

Reported by: Leo Liu <sdl.web <at> gmail.com>

Date: Mon, 25 Aug 2014 08:04:01 UTC

Severity: wishlist

Tags: fixed, patch

Found in version 24.4.50

Done: Lars Ingebrigtsen <larsi <at> gnus.org>

Bug is archived. No further changes may be made.

Full log


Message #11 received at 18327 <at> debbugs.gnu.org (full text, mbox):

From: Stefan Monnier <monnier <at> iro.umontreal.ca>
To: Leo Liu <sdl.web <at> gmail.com>
Cc: 18327 <at> debbugs.gnu.org
Subject: Re: bug#18327: 24.4.50; [PATCH] vector QPattern for pcase
Date: Thu, 04 Sep 2014 12:21:59 -0400
> The attached patch (inspired by your byte-code-function qpattern patch)
> seems to add vector QPattern to pcase. Could you review it and give me
> any comments? Thanks.

Please double-check that it doesn't break bootstrap (CL uses pcase as
well, and I have some vague recollection of bumping into problems in
this area, which is why pcase doesn't use CL).

Also the patch needs to update pcase's docstring (based on my
understanding of your code, you only handle qpatterns of the form
[QPAT1..QPATn], right?).


        Stefan




This bug report was last modified 9 years and 87 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.